  1. When I open any Nikon raw file (.NEF extension), the image is always 1 to 2 stops too dark. I must increase the exposure just to see the detail. When I then develop and export the image, it is overexposed by the same 1 to 2 stops. I did not have this problem with earlier versions. It only began a few days ago when I updated to 1.7.2. So the questions are (a) is this a bug? and (b) have I overlooked some preference or other setting that affects the initial display of raw images? Thanks, Dick

  5. Hey guys... I've been using AD a lot in the last year and I wanted to share with you some of the results. As you can see in these images, my main project consists of creating Windows 10 Themes, which is basically UI design... and in this department, AD has no actual competition on Windows (Adobe XD is far too featureless for what I need and PS is a nightmare to use for UI design). While working with tons of artboards and a lot of exports, this is where AD shines, as the Export Persona makes my life a whole lot easier. But at the same time, I found some flaws in AD, which is not a bad thing because I was able to do my part in the community and offer experiential feedback to help improve the app. Now, what can I say about my work... the theme above is called Simplify 10 Dark Colorful which is inspired partially by the MacOS UI, and bellow I have something for the Linux fans as well, a collection of 10 themes called Maverick 10 which is inspired by the Ubuntu design language. Over time I made many other themes and I also use AD for web design exclusively now and in time I hope to make it my main design tool.
